The barrel of a ri?e has a length of 0.942 m. A bullet leaves the muzzle of a ri?e with a speed of 580 m/s. What is the acceleration of the bullet while in the barrel? A bullet in a ri?e barrel does not have constant acceleration, but constant acceleration is to be assumed for this problem. Answer in units of m/s 2
